Transaction 720cbccfacdd1d9e14991bcbc4bd615490d607a95a0a15707554f2d5fdf7e997

1 Input
2 Outputs
  • 720cbccfacdd1d9e14991bcbc4bd615490d607a95a0a15707554f2d5fdf7e997:0
  • value  552000
    address  3JwC2VFEFKRV9wnEkkvFwzAXJbrwXN8Dt2
  • 720cbccfacdd1d9e14991bcbc4bd615490d607a95a0a15707554f2d5fdf7e997:1
  • value  138346108
    address  17TvWkGjeeC5oyV3AgLn3BeqYg3W2nezzK